MARGAO
Atletico de Kolkata have agreed terms with East Bengal to sign Bikash Jairu on loan for the next edition of the Indian Super League (ISL).
The 25-year-old, who turned up for FC Pune City last season, was on the radar of as many as six ISL franchises before Atletico de Kolkata managed to prise him away.
Jairu was arguably one of the best Indian players in the 2015-16 I-League season before he picked up an injury in the 2018 World Cup qualifier tie against Iran in March.
Apart from his three goals, he assisted several goals and was a key component of Biswajit Bhattacharya’s team.
The former Mumbai Tigers winger will look to replicate his form of East Bengal at Atletico de Kolkata after a rather disappointing stint with FC Pune City in his first ISL season.
